M & W is a r e c i p r o c a l i n t e r i n s u r a n c e exchange organized under

s e c t i o n 10-13-101, e t seq., C o l o .Rev . S t a t . ( 1973 ) . Reciprocal interinsurance exchanges are recognized in Montana by section 33-5-101 e t seq., MCA. An i n t e r i n s u r a n c e e x c h a n g e is a method of

c r e a t i n g an insurance fund whereby t h e p o l i c y h o l d e r s , known as

subscribers, operate individually and collectively through an

attorney-in-fact to provide reciprocal insurance among them- selves. V i a a n exchange of i n d e m n i t y , e a c h s u b s c r i b e r is b o t h a n insured and an insurer of each of the other subscribers. E x c h a n g e premiums t a k e t h e form o f i n i t i a l d e p o s i t s made by each subscriber. A t t h e end o f each y e a r t h e s u b s c r i b e r s e i t h e r receive the excess of premiums paid over claims and expenses p a i d , or become c o n t i n g e n t l y l i a b l e f o r e x c e s s claims and expen- ses o v e r premiums p a i d . Thus, the subscribers can receive a

r e t u r n i n a good y e a r b u t may h a v e t o p a y a d d i t i o n a l premiums i n

a bad y e a r . In 1975, M & W1s claims and expenses exceeded the total amount o f premiums p a i d .
